在信息技术迅猛发展的今天,软件考试(软考)在我国已成为衡量IT人才专业技能的重要标准之一。对于广大IT从业者来说,通过软考不仅能够提升自身技能,还对职业晋升和薪资待遇有着积极影响。本文将就软考数据库中级考试的试题答案及考试技巧展开讨论,希望对广大考生有所帮助。
一、软考数据库中级考试概述
软考数据库中级考试主要考察考生在数据库设计、管理、优化等方面的实际能力。考试内容涵盖了关系数据库、非关系数据库、数据库设计、数据库性能优化等多个方面。考试形式为闭卷笔试,考试时间为150分钟。
二、试题答案解析
以下是近几年软考数据库中级考试的部分试题及答案解析:
1. 【试题】什么是数据库的范式?请简述第一范式、第二范式和第三范式的定义。
【答案】数据库的范式是数据库设计的基本理论,用于指导数据库结构的优化。第一范式要求数据库表的每一列都是不可分割的原子项;第二范式要求在满足第一范式的基础上,表中的所有非主键列都完全依赖于主键;第三范式要求在满足第二范式的基础上,表中的每一列都不传递依赖于主键。
2. 【试题】请解释索引的作用以及常见的索引类型。
【答案】索引是数据库中用于提高检索速度的一种数据结构。通过创建索引,可以快速定位到表中的特定数据行。常见的索引类型包括B树索引、哈希索引、位图索引等。其中,B树索引适用于大多数场景,哈希索引适用于等值查询,位图索引适用于低基数列。
3. 【试题】请简述数据库事务的四个特性(ACID)。
【答案】数据库事务的四个特性分别为原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)和持久性(Durability),简称ACID。原子性指事务是一个不可分割的工作单位,要么全部完成,要么全部不完成;一致性指事务必须使数据库从一个一致状态转变到另一个一致状态;隔离性指一个事务的执行不能被其他事务干扰;持久性指一个事务一旦提交,它对数据库中数据的改变就是永久性的。
三、备考建议与技巧
1. 系统学习:建议考生参加专业的培训班或自学相关教材,系统掌握数据库相关知识。
2. 多做练习:通过大量的练习题和模拟试题来检验自己的学习成果,提高答题速度和准确度。
3. 关注考试动态:及时了解考试大纲和考试要求的变化,调整备考策略。
4. 时间管理:在考试过程中,合理分配时间,确保每道题目都有足够的时间进行思考和作答。
5. 心态调整:保持积极的心态,相信自己能够通过考试,避免因紧张而影响发挥。
总之,软考数据库中级考试作为衡量IT人才数据库技能的重要标准,对于IT从业者来说具有重要意义。通过系统学习、多做练习、关注考试动态、合理管理时间和调整心态等方法,相信广大考生能够顺利通过考试,为自己的职业发展添砖加瓦。